Ingredients & Substitutions

Rotisserie Chicken: This is the star of the salad and makes it so easy! You can use any leftover cooked chicken if you don’t have rotisserie. Just shred it up and you’re good to go.

Celery: Fresh celery adds a nice crunch. If you’re not a fan, try using diced cucumbers or bell peppers instead. They can give a similar texture.

Red Onion: The red onion brings in a slightly sweet flavor and color. If red onion is too strong for you, consider using green onions or shallots for a milder taste.

Mayonnaise: It adds creaminess to the salad. If you’re looking for a lighter option, plain yogurt or a mix of yogurt and mayo works well. Avocado also makes for a delicious substitute!

Lemon Juice: This adds a fresh zing! If you don’t have lemon, lime juice can be a tasty alternative, giving a slightly different but refreshing flavor.

How Do I Make Sure My Chicken Salad Has the Right Consistency?

Getting the right texture is key to a delightful chicken salad. You want it creamy but not overly soggy. Here’s how you can achieve that:

  • Start with less mayo than you think you’ll need. You can always add more after mixing!
  • Mix the salad thoroughly to coat all ingredients, but avoid over-mixing, which can make it mushy.
  • Chill the salad for 30 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ld and gives it a better texture!

Play around with the mayo or yogurt until you find that perfect creaminess that you enjoy the most.

How to Make Easy Rotisserie Chicken Salad

Ingredients You’ll Need:

  • 3 cups cooked rotisserie chicken, shredded or chopped
  • 1 cup celery, finely chopped
  • ½ cup red onion, finely chopped
  • ½ cup mayonnaise (adjust to your preferred creaminess)
  • 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ice
  • ½ tsp salt, or to taste
  • ¼ tsp black pepper, plus more for garnish
  • Optional: pita chips or crackers for serving

How Much Time Will You Need?

This delicious rotisserie chicken salad takes about 10 minutes to prepare and then just 30 minutes to chill in the refrigerator. So, in about 40 minutes, you’ll be ready to enjoy a tasty meal or snack!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Combine the Ingredients

Start by taking a large mixing bowl. Add the shredded rotisserie chicken, finely chopped celery, and red onion to the bowl. You’ll want to make sure the chicken is in small, bite-sized pieces for easy eating.

2. Add the Creaminess

Now, pour in the mayonnaise and squeeze in the fresh lemon juice. This will give your salad a creamy texture and a nice zing of flavor!

3. Mix It Well

Using a spatula or large spoon, mix everything together thoroughly. Make sure the chicken and veggies get evenly coated with the mayonnaise!

4. Seasoning Time

Sprinkle in the salt and black pepper, then mix again to distribute the seasoning evenly. It’s a good idea to taste at this stage—if you feel it needs more flavor, go ahead and adjust the salt and pepper!

5. Chill Out

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or transfer your chicken salad to an airtight container. Place it in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This will let all the flavors blend beautifully together.

6. Serve and Enjoy

When you’re ready to eat, take the salad out of the fridge. Give it one last gentle stir and garnish with a sprinkle of black pepper. Serve it cold with some pita chips or your favorite crackers on the side.

Enjoy your quick, creamy, and crunchy chicken salad as a light meal or snack! Perfect for any day of the week!

Can I Use Leftover Chicken for This Recipe?

Absolutely! Any leftover cooked chicken works perfectly. Just shred or chop it into bite-sized pieces to use in the salad.

Can I Make This Salad Ahead of Time?

Yes! You can prepare the chicken salad a day in advance. Just keep it covered in the refrigerator. The flavors will actually get better as it sits!

How Do I Store Leftover Chicken Salad?

Store any leftover chicken salad in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. To serve, simply give it a good stir before enjoying it again.

What Can I Substitute for Mayonnaise?

If you’re looking for a lighter option, try using plain Greek yogurt or a mix of yogurt and mayonnaise for a delicious twist. Mashed avocado can also be a tasty, creamy substitute!
